Nettet13. okt. 2024 · Chronic Lower Back Pain (CLBP) is a condition of the mind as much as the body: anxiety, stress, depression, trauma and other mental health issues can actually cause physical pain and make existing pain worse. So you might notice that your pain feels worse when you’re worried or feeling down, or struggling with a trauma.
